Lake Almanor Country Club occupies a stretch of high-altitude terrain defined by the expansive, reflective basin of Lake Almanor. It lies 28.4 miles west-southwest of Susanville, CA (from Susanville, CA: bearing 246°T), and is situated 0.3 miles east-southeast of Lake Almanor. The land here rises in measured increments, moving from the water’s edge into dense stands of pine and fir that signal the broader presence of Lassen National Forest just two miles away.
